Ready to Innovate Your Business for the Future? Join Us at LEAP 2025 in Riyadh, Saudi Arabia, 9-12 Feb 2025

Book Meeting Now!

“Netflix and Chill”,

You must be aware of this phrase, right? Nowadays, it is the most popular phrase among people, especially Gen Z. Also, Netflix is the only name that comes to mind whenever anyone talks about binge-watching.

According to Statista, Netflix is considered the leading video streaming platform between April 2022 and January 2024 based on the number of monthly visits. This popular SVoD streaming service recorded around 1.47 billion visits in the evaluation time. Prime Video got second rank, and Disney Plus was in third position.    

With the increasing interest of people in OTT content, the demand for Netflix app development is also increasing. Businesses are showing keen interest in knowing “How much it costs to develop an app like Netflix” as they are looking forward to tapping into this lucrative market. 

Guess what?.. Here, we are going to provide you with a cost estimation for Netflix, like app development, if you are also looking for the same.  

The estimated Netflix clone app development cost will range between $25,000 and $100,000. Moreover, you need to explore the complete guide to learn detailed information on Netflix clone mobile app development costs.

In addition, the guide below covers the process of how to develop an app like Netflix, including essential features, and why businesses need to invest in Netflix mobile app development.

Let’s dive into the details:

Overview of Netflix: It’s Journey, Milestones, and Evolution

Netflix was launched in 1997 by Reed Hastings and Marc Randolph as a DVD rental-by-mail service, carrying an advancement to the standard video rental stores. Then, after a year, they launched their official DVD rental and sales website, which has played a significant role in their success.

2007 was a turning point for them when Netflix announced the offer of online streaming services to bring a revolution to the entertainment world. Then, it set a milestone by launching the original content, ‘House of Cards,’ in 2013.

The app was made available in more than 190 countries in 2016 and then achieved 100 million subscribers in 2017. It took no time to hit 200 million by 2020 during the COVID-19 pandemic.

Since then, it has been setting new standards for OTT content delivery, from introducing binge-watching culture to applying advanced recommendation algorithms.    

The success of Netflix has affected video streaming businesses worldwide, and now, they are looking for ‘Netflix clone app development.’

Even the best OTT app development companies, on-demand video streaming app developers, and business persons are diving deep into its business model and other elements to learn what it takes to create the best video-on-demand application. 

Here is a roadmap to Netflix’s journey so far-

Netflix app journey

Check Out the Working Process of the Video Streaming App

A video streaming app like Netflix provides users with a wide variety of content, including popular TV series, best movies, documentaries, and games according to their taste.

To manage these all according to the user demands, video streaming apps need to follow a proper working process that is as follows:

Content Processing Request

When users request the content, the app conveys this request to the server to get the required data and verifies if the content is available. Then, it sends small data packets of audio and video to the user, and the process continues for a while.   

Content Delivery Networks (CDNs)

CDN technology is used to decrease the time consumed by the process of data transfer while ensuring efficient video delivery by delivering content on geographically distributed servers.

When a user requests content, the nearby CDN delivers it at a fast speed, reducing page buffering time and optimizing the user experience.   

Compressed Videos Ensuring High-quality

Videos are compressed and only encoded when requested by users without compromising quality. They are encoded using formats like HEVC and H.264 while allowing for rapid data transmission over networks, leading to better streaming speed across different devices.

ABS (Adaptive Bitrate Streaming)

Whenever the app users have slow internet connectivity, their video will not stop or buffer. Instead, the app will adjust the video quality using this algorithm.

ABS works like a Smart system that monitors the users’ internet speed and decreases the video quality accordingly to ensure the best viewing experience.

DRM (Digital Rights Management)

Video Streaming apps ensure the protection of video content by applying encryption and only allowing subscribed users to watch the content. Any business that is looking to create an app like Netflix must consider DRM.

Compatibility across Devices

Video streaming apps must be compatible with a diverse range of devices to target a large number of users. You can build an app like Netflix that is compatible with devices like smart TVs, smartphones, and desktops.

Moreover, you can use AI and ML to provide users with personalized experience and keep them engaged.  

Read More: How to Develop Short Video App?

Video Streaming Apps: Market Size and Growth

There has always been a prominent demand for video streaming apps over the years. The emergence of the latest technologies, such as Artificial Intelligence, Blockchain, Augmented Reality, Machine Learning, etc., has also ignited the video streaming app market.

Consider that the global video streaming market size was esteemed at US$ 555.89 billion in 2023. The overall market is estimated to evolve from US$ 674.25 billion in 2024 to US$ 2660.88 billion by 2032 at an 18.7% CAGR, according to the reports of Fortune Business Insights.   

If we look at the statistics by Grand View Research, the global video streaming market size is forecasted to hit US$ 416.84 billion by 2030 at a 21.5% CAGR from 2024 to 2030.

As of July 2024, Sony Live hit the graph of the global downloads of selected mobile streaming apps with around 15.6 million downloads, followed by Netflix with 14 million downloads.

Want to know more? Have a look at the below pointers if you are looking to build an app like Netflix:

  • Netflix had $33.7 billion in revenue in 2023, with a 6.6% increase every year.
  • Netflix generated a net income of $5.4 billion in 2023, with a 20.4% increase from the last year.
  • As of 2023, Netflix had 238.3 million app subscribers globally.
  • A huge portion of Netflix’s revenue, which is $14 billion, was generated in the largest market, North America.
Video Streaming Apps Market Stats

Significant Reasons for Businesses to Invest in OTT Apps like Netflix

Before capitalizing on any sector, businesses must conduct a detailed analysis to evaluate whether they should invest or not. Netflix app development is a secure investment, but still; you must learn about its benefits. Check out below:

Growing Video Streaming App Market

There is a vast global market for video streaming apps like Netflix, Disney Plus, etc., with millions of users who are shifting from traditional TV to these OTT platforms. Hence, building an online streaming app like Netflix will only enable them to enter a massive market enthusiastically and cater to a diverse habit of content consumers, having a high potential for the future.

Higher User Engagement & Retention

Online streaming platforms provide users with personalized and entertaining content in different categories, including the latest features such as AI chat, watch lists, multiple device access, etc. It delivers an augmented user experience, leading to higher user engagement, retention, and sustainable growth.

Data-driven Decision-making

Netflix clone app development will facilitate businesses to consume vast amounts of user data, including their viewing habits, behavior, preferences, and patterns. This valuable data can be used by businesses to optimize user experience, provide better content, and create targeted marketing strategies, leading to improved decision-making.

Control over Content

When businesses develop an app like Netflix, they get complete control of the displayed content, branding, and audience dealings. It enables them to develop better brand approaches, improve personalization, and generate the capability to create exclusive content pieces, delivering a more interactive experience for their users.   

Brand Visibility and Recognition

Launching an OTT app like Netflix is highly advantageous for businesses as it enables them to have better brand visibility and recognition. These apps act according to their users’ preferences, including providing them with quality and engaging content, planning subscriptions to make it affordable for users, and creating lists to watch the content later, which is beneficial to make them popular in the entertainment industry.  

Visit Also: How to Develop Video Conferencing App Like Zoom?

cta-1

Amazing Features to Make Your Netflix Clone App More Appealing

“Which features do you want to add when developing an app like Netflix?” is the most important question you need to consider. From profile creation to watch list to personalized recommendations, you need to add significant features to your OTT app to grab the attention of your audience.

Check out the list of features below:

User Panel

Here are some required features for the user panel:

Register or Login:

Users can create their app profile using their name, contact number, or email. Every profile will include a watch list, settings, watch history, and log-out options.  

Multiple User Profiles:

The app allows users to have multiple profiles under a single account. For this, they must have a premium app subscription.

Content Search & Filters:

Users can search the required content using advanced search functionality and various filters like language, genre, year, etc., to improve the search results.

Add Watch List:

Users can add the movies they want to watch later to their watch list or mark them as favorites so that they can easily access them and won’t have to search again.  

Watch Offline

Users can download content, such as movies, shows, etc., within the app and can watch them even if they don’t have access to the internet. Consider that it comes with an expiration date.

Secure Payment Gateway:

Users are provided with multiple payment gateways, ensuring security so that they can make payments without any hesitation and have a consistent experience.

Multi-language Support:

Users in different regions can watch content in their native languages along with the subtitles. This feature is used to cater to the global audience.

Push Notifications:

Notify users about all the app updates, including new releases, upcoming shows, recommendations, reminders, etc., to get higher engagement and retention.

Social Sharing:

Let users share their updates and current movie tracks with their friends on different social media platforms, leading to better app visibility and interaction.

Admin Panel

Here are some required features for the user panel:

User Management:

The admin can manage all the users within the app or add or remove them. They can manage users’ profiles, passwords, subscriptions, etc. while monitoring their activities.

Content Management System:

The content within the video streaming app is managed by the admin. They oversee the content library, categorize it by genre, upload new content, and manage the license expiration date.  

Subscription & Payment Management:

An admin must handle subscription plans, free trials & discounts, and available payment gateways. They also monitor transactions and payment status to ensure a seamless revenue flow.   

Analytics Dashboard:

A fully accessible analytics dashboard helps the admin view real-time statistics comprising user engagement, app downloads, content performance, and subscription progress. It helps them to elevate the user experience and make better decisions.

Push Notification Management:

Admin has the right to customize the notifications sent to users according to user preferences, loyalty, demographics, or behavior for better engagement and acquisition.

Content Licensing & DRM:

Admins can manage the app license requirements to publish third-party content while implementing DRM tools to ensure authorized access and prevent piracy. It helps the app to deliver users legally secured content only.

User Feedback and Reports:

Admins monitor user feedback and address all the related issues. They also track user complaints, collect insights, and manage customer support to augment the overall app experience.

Advanced Features

Here are some required features for the user panel:

Personalized AI Recommendations:

With the use of Artificial Intelligence-powered algorithms, it is easy to evaluate user behavior and preferences to recommend personalized suggestions, leading to better user engagement.

Adaptive Bitrate Streaming:

The app facilitates users with smooth video playback by allowing them to adjust the video quality in real time according to their network bandwidth. It makes the users’ streaming experience better even on inconsistent connections.

Cloud-based Storage:

Video streaming apps with cloud storage facilitate secure data storage, scalability, and easy access to content for users as they can watch movies, shows, etc., from anywhere. It also helps the app swiftly expand the content library without any extra investment.

Multi-device Sync:

Video streaming app users can easily switch between multiple devices and can continue from where they left off on the previous device. It facilitates users with a smooth content shift across devices, leading to improved retention.

Blockchain-based Security:

Netflix app developers integrate Blockchain technology to ensure decentralized and transparent payment services for users while securing their data. It guarantees tamper-proof transactions and better privacy that makes users feel secure.  

Must-Have Revenue Models for Netflix Clone Apps

After learning about how to develop an app like Netflix, you must want to know about how video streaming makes money, right? We’ve got you all covered here; below are the popular monetization strategies applied by popular video streaming apps like Netflix.

Hire a top video streaming app development company and integrate them into your solution to get higher revenue. Check out them:

App Subscription Model

The most popular revenue model for video-on-demand apps is to offer subscription plans to users. They can choose among multiple subscription options, including monthly, three-month, quarterly, or yearly.

Different plans have different features. Basic features will allow users to access the app on one device only with limited features, while advanced ones will let users watch the content on multiple devices with better features and quality.  

Pay-Per-View Model

This monetization model in Netflix clone apps enables users to pay one-time fees to access some exclusive live events, movies, or other content. This model applies to some high-demanding content that is available on the app for a limited time only.

This model allows businesses to earn money on some individual content pieces without asking users for a subscription and provide them with the specific content they want.     

Brand Collaboration and Sponsorship

OTT applications can collaborate or partner with other brands to display their content or promote them within the movies or shows. It is the most applied monetization model by video streaming apps, where brands pay apps to showcase their products or services.

It is a new way to do advertisements without disrupting the user experience; hence, it is preferred by most businesses.  

Content Licensing

Businesses who want to create an app like Netflix must consider this monetization strategy. In this, video streaming apps can license their content to presenters or third-party platforms. They can sell exclusive rights to other OTT platforms to stream particular content.

In exchange, they can earn bonus revenue by leveraging their selected content offerings and growing their reach via other channels.

Click Here: How to Develop Video Sharing App?

Core Technologies Create an App like Netflix

When you are going to create a video streaming app like Netflix, you must hire expert developers with rich knowledge of modern technologies. They will help you have a smooth functionality app and make it a huge success in the market.

Here is the below technology stack Netflix app developers use to build a high-quality and proficient solution:

TechnologiesAndroidiOSWeb
Programming LanguagesJava, KotlinObjective-C, SwiftJavaScript, TypeScript
Back-end LanguagesJava, Node.js, KotlinSwift, Python, Node.jsNode.js, Ruby on Rails, Python
FrameworksAndroid SDK, ExoPlayeriOS SDK, AVFoundationReact.js, Vue.js, Angular
Streaming ProtocolsHLS, MPEG-DASHHLS, MPEG-DASHHLS, MPEG-DASH
DatabaseMySQL, Firebase Firestore, PostgreSQLMySQL, Firebase Firestore, PostgreSQLMySQL, Firebase Firestore, PostgreSQL
APIs
RESTful APIs, GraphQL 

RESTful APIs, GraphQL 

RESTful APIs, GraphQL 
Cloud StorageAWS S3, Google Cloud StorageAWS S3, Google Cloud StorageAWS S3, Google Cloud Storage

How to Develop an App Like Netflix: A Complete Process?

Now, we will learn about Netflix’s mobile app development process for creating a similar video streaming app. From project ideation to developing the back end to launching the solution, you will need the assistance of a leading video streaming app development company; hence, choose wisely.

Following is the step-by-step process:

Identify Your Niche and Conduct Market Research

Before creating a video-on-demand app, you need to go through detailed market research and find the latest trends and features. Analyze the competitors, how they are meeting the users’ demand, and what they lack. Try to conduct a SWOT analysis to identify possible opportunities and threats.

After collecting all the required data, determine the app features and functionalities. Create a business plan including key value propositions, project timeline, cost, and milestones.  

Designing User Interface and User Experience

If your video streaming application has an interactive and appealing interface along with easy-to-use and unique features, it will instantly grab the users’ attention. Ensure that you have creative UI/UX designers on your mobile app development team to get simple app navigation, attractive layouts, responsive designs, multi-screen support, and others.

Also, while designing the Netflix clone app development, you need to focus on key features to ensure that users will like using the app.   

Creating Back-end Infrastructure

Developing the back end of a video streaming app is a crucial part of the process. For this, you need to hire mobile app developers who have extensive experience in a similar domain to help you build a proficient video-on-demand app. The back-end development process will include writing code and integrating databases, servers, etc.    

Ensure to have secure and smooth data management, enabling real-time access to enormous media libraries across multiple regions. 

While getting OTT mobile app development services, you must consider legal compliance to get permission for content distribution and copyright on your platform, including movies, shows, music, and others. You must go through legal registration and content licensing to stream the videos in the right manner.

While obtaining Netflix mobile app development services, you need to have all the legal documents so that you won’t face any issues in publishing content on your OTT platform.

Quality Assurance and Deployment

After you are done with the Netflix app development process, it’s time to test the developed application based on performance, security, integrity, etc. There are different kinds of testing procedures, including black box and white box, that you can consider to make your app error-free. Also, test the app to see if it can handle heavy traffic loads.

Now, launch the app on chosen platforms, be it Android, iOS, or web. To ensure a smooth app launch, follow the app store optimization guidelines for the particular platform. Moreover, you need to invest in digital marketing to promote your app via social media campaigns.    

How Much Does It Cost to Develop an App Like Netflix?

As we have mentioned earlier, the Netflix clone mobile app development cost will range between $25,000 and $100,000. There are diverse factors that can vary this estimated cost. Hence, to get an exact estimation, you need to have clearly defined project specifications that consider aspects like the number of platforms, app features, and functions, number of experts, hosting servers, location, and experience of the development company.    

In addition, the time consumed in the Netflix app development process will also impact the overall cost. Also, if you have a high budget, you must go for the advanced features and functions to make your app worth the attention, and if you have a limited budget, ensure to have essential core features only to develop a simple and intuitive Netflix clone app.

Different Factors Varying the Netflix Clone App Development Cost

Cost to Develop an App Like Netflix

Every business is concerned about this question, but here we are to help you with the detailed factors affecting the general video streaming app development cost. Check out them:

App Features and Functionality

The more advanced features you add to your Netflix clone app, the more complex it will be. Also, it will directly impact your overall Netflix mobile app development cost. These features can be AI personalized recommendations, adaptive streaming, multiple device support, and others.

Choosing basic features will help you build an app like Netflix on a limited budget, but you must have a high budget to create an advanced video streaming app.

Number of Platforms

If you want to develop an app like Netflix for one platform, whether it is Android or iOS, you can get it on a decided budget. Consider that an app developed for a single platform will limit your audience reach.

Getting a cross-platform app that supports multiple platforms such as iOS, Android, and the web will reach a large audience base globally, but it may offer you less optimization compared to native apps.    

Content Licensing

To build an app like Netflix, you will need to acquire licensed content that can highly vary your general video streaming app development cost. It will be based on agreements with studios, content creators, and applicable holders.

If you want to go for the original content, then it will cost you more to buy high-quality movies, series, or shows.  

Third-party Integrations

While looking for Netflix mobile app development, it is necessary to know about the integrations you want in your app, as it will have a huge impact on the budget. These third-party integrations can be analytics, payment gateways, customer support systems, and others that add intricacy and cost to the project.   

Ongoing Support & Maintenance

Sometimes, businesses want to get continuous support and maintenance services from the video streaming app development company they hire, but it adds additional costs. These services might include bug fixing, security updates, feature adding, and others.

Having these services will directly increase your overall project cost by up to 15 to 20%; hence, decide accordingly.

Final Words

In the above Netflix app development guide, we have defined all the essential aspects, including features, the monetization model, estimated costs, and cost-affecting factors. With the rising demand for video streaming apps, businesses are showing more interest in having Netflix clone app development services while going through a comprehensive market and competitor research.

As a well-known video streaming app development company, Octal IT Solution is also assisting businesses looking to set new standards in the entertainment industry. Our 24*7 support services and transparent development process make us outshine our competitors. Partner with our vetted team to develop an app like Netflix with innovative features.   

cta-2

FAQs:

THE AUTHOR
Managing Director
WebisteFacebookInstagramLinkedinyoutube

Arun G Goyal is a tech enthusiast and experienced writer. He's known for his insightful blog posts, where he shares his expertise gained from years in the tech industry. Arun shares his knowledge and insights through engaging blog posts, making him a respected figure in the field.

Previous Post Next Post

Get in Touch

    Octal In The News

    Octal IT Solution Has Been Featured By Reputed Publishers Globally

    Let’s Build Something Great Together!

    Connect with us and discover new possibilities.

      Gain More With Your Field Service

      We’re always keeping our finger on the pulse of the industry. Browse our resources and learn more.

      Let's schedule a call
      Mobile App Development Mobile App Development
      error: Content is protected !!